> Log:
> <rdar://problem/13426257> Introduce SDKSettings.plist as an input file dependency for PCH/modules.
>
> When we're building a precompiled header or module against an SDK on
> Darwin, there will be a file SDKSettings.plist in the sysroot. Since
> stat()'ing every system header on which a module or PCH file depends
> is performance suicide, we instead stat() just SDKSettings.plist. This
> hack works well on Darwin; it's unclear how we want to handle this on
> other platforms. If there is a canonical file, we should use it; if
> not, we either have to take the performance hit of stat()'ing system
> headers repeatedly or roll the dice by not checking anything.

> + // If we have an isysroot for a Darwin SDK, include its SDKSettings.plist in
> + // the set of (non-system) input files. This is simple heuristic for
> + // detecting whether the system headers may have changed, because it is too
> + // expensive to stat() all of the system headers.
> + FileManager &FileMgr = SourceMgr.getFileManager();
> + if (!HSOpts.Sysroot.empty()) {
> + llvm::SmallString<128> SDKSettingsFileName(HSOpts.Sysroot);
> + llvm::sys::path::append(SDKSettingsFileName, "SDKSettings.plist");
> + if (const FileEntry *SDKSettingsFile = FileMgr.getFile(SDKSettingsFileName)) {
> + InputFileEntry Entry = { SDKSettingsFile, false, false };
> + SortedFiles.push_front(Entry);
> + }
> }
